                                                Systems Overview

 Today Software offers two suites of Integrated POS and Retail Management software:

 

POSperfect II

 POSperfect is the POS and Branch Back Office system. It is written in Delphi and the latest versions use an Interbase or Firebird database through the InterBase Objects (IBO) Database engine.

The principle design criteria was that “The POS Terminals must not depend on a Server or Network to process sales” and that “Online/Offline transitions must be seamless”.

 The system maintains a mission critical database on every terminal so that the POS functions are not Server dependent. This allows the POS terminal to function when a network or Server is down which eliminates the need and cost of a Backup Server to achieve redundancy. In addition this design divorces the POS processing functions from any network or Server bottlenecks so that a major processing task on the Server does not impact on standard sales processing. The background network management processes in POSperfect handle any offline/online conditions seamlessly.

The Server or Master terminal for each store maintains an up-to-the-minute detailed stock and sales history of every stock item movement and every transaction. In addition, the database automatically consolidates individual product history into group history for up to 4 hierarchical groups (e.g. Department/Class), plus Vendor consolidation and up to 4 horizontal user definable groups e.g. Label, Brand, Pack Type, etc. The system also supports SKU/PLU, SKU/Barcode and SKU/Size/Colour (matrix) merchandise types.

POSperfect provides a comprehensive suite of reports that allow reporting across ANY Date Range , and with drill-down through the group levels to individual products and a detailed audit trail of every stock movement and transaction. No 3rd party reporting tools are required. Flexible data export facilities are provided for loading into 3rd party applications.

POSperfect also provides a Multi-Store Controller (MSC) that manages a Wide Area (WAN) or a DUN (Dial-Up) network with multiple stores. Updates and data retrieval into the Multi-Store Controller system is seamless and automatic. The MSC offers individual or consolidated reporting for a single store or all stores. Typically an MSC will be the Back Office of the main store or Administration store.

 

Corporate Controller

The Corporate Controller (CC) is a multi-branch Retail Management System written in the Progress 9 GUI (Graphical User Interface) Development Suite and typically using the Progress RDBMS database.

The CC retrieves every transaction and stock movement from every store and records this in its database. The database is designed for maximum efficiency and performance when reporting on sales and inventory in large retail chains. The store selections are completely versatile so that any combinations of any stores linked to store types, regions, advertising groups etc may be selected for a report and the report optionally consolidated.

Drill down is also provided with Graphical reporting at any of the drill down levels. In a few seconds the system can provide an Inventory snapshot report for any combination of stores and across any date period with consolidation of stores if required.

Powerful tools for central administration of the many aspects of the Product/Price and Group catalogues are available. The flexibility of the database and communications allows for data elements to be either centrally or store level maintained, and for different stores to have different capabilities.

The CC can allow store level inventory management, or central inventory management. A Centralised Purchase Ordering system allows single purchase orders for multiple stores/warehouses integrated with store level stock receipting and Interbranch Transfers. The CC retains a copy of every inventory order or other control document such as Inter-brand Transfers, and distributes these documents to each branch system.

Flexible Fiscal periods can be defined for Weeks, Months, Years, Seasons and other user defined fiscal periods. A suite of integrated multi-branch accounting modules are integrated with the inventory, stock, sales and purchasing modules to deliver a comprehensive and flexible multi-branch Retail Management System integrated with the POSperfect POS and Branch Back Office system.

The data communications between systems are integrated into the applications, but make use of standard TCP-IP networking protocols. Communications can be inline (permanent but non-dependent) connections to each store, or via scheduled batch polling.
